Artisan is a plugin that genuinely redefines what's possible in Trimble SketchUp, transforming a tool often stereotyped as a "box‑drawing program" into a powerful platform for organic modeling. With Artisan, users can create smooth, curved surfaces and intricate details that would be difficult or impossible to achieve using standard SketchUp tools. This toolset has been widely adopted by professionals and hobbyists alike, who appreciate its ability to streamline the design process and unlock new creative possibilities.
